a/c help
i got this problem with my a/c when the car is at operating temperature and the car isnt moving the a/c doesnt cool as good as if the car was moving are there anythings i should check i think i might it might be low in coolant. thats just onething idk if maybe the compressor is bad but it turns on and cools the car very well when its moving but when its at idle in a parking lot or drive thru it start to blow hot air. can someone please help me thanks

most likely your fan/s arent kicking in. when you drive air blows through your radiator/condincer and keeps it cool. your car has two fans one on the condincer/radiator, and one on the radiator. so if your car is overheating then neither are kicking in, but if its normal temp then only your condincer fan isnt kicking in.

things that cause hot air while trying to get cold A/C:
bugs, and debris in your condensor.
fans not working
air blend door not working properly (whether its cable misadjustment or vacuum line problems)
and other less likely problems.
edit: rev it up next time you're sitting still. If revving it helps, then you may need to top it off with refrigerant.
